    I have done this with an HD1023, XD1033, and XT1144.  You can use any BrightSign player with GPIO ports.

    Motion sensor with adjustable range and hold times:

    www.hms-electronics.com

    Model PIR-Z-B

    Also consider purchasing the TB12-RJ12 Motion detector adapter and the RG12 cable to make initial testing easier.

    Finally got it.

    On the Bright Author page: Event Handler to GPIO event, using buttons 1-7, all connected in the "Down" Position to the WAV file, connected to the Media End Event
